Guest guest Posted June 2, 2009 Report Share Posted June 2, 2009 Hello, I am hoping Dr. Furman or any of you have had the same problem can help me. I had two treatments with FCR. The first time my blood pressure dropped and the rituxin had to be stopped and could not be restarted until the next day. A month later when I had the second treatment, I started having chills and running a fever on the same day as the rituxin was started. Both times the FC was given without any problems. After the second round of FCR, I continued to run a fever, and was very weak. I was hospitalized for 12 days with neutrophils of less than 100, hg of 7.7, and developed peripheral neuropathy in lower legs. I received transfusions, neupogen, and IV antibiotics. Later it was determined that I developed macrophagic activation syndrome and my immune system was hyperactived from the FCR and would not be able to take it again. My neutrophils now are about 1000 and hg is 9.2. I need to try another treatment because my bone marrow is still 50-60% leukemic cells. My MD mentioned revlimid, flavoperidol, or another monoclonal antibody. I really had my heart set on FCR because I have a problem with 11q deletion.
